
Maryland’s Q Da Fool is looking to take his burgeoning rap career to the next level. On Monday (May 14), Roc Nation announced a new record deal with the 21-year-old rising star. With major label backing now at his disposal, Q’s focus switches to his 100 Keys EP, which is slated to release this summer.
The project will be produced exclusively by ATL mainstay Zaytoven and that’s an opportunity the No Competition rapper isn’t taking for granted. “Working with Zaytoven on this EP has been a dope experience for me,” the DMV native tells Billboard. “I mean, Zay is a legend in the game and when he sent me the first set of beats, I knew then that this 100 Keys EP was going to be a classic project for me.”
The former Pakk Boyz member is celebrating his latest business venture with the release of the Zaytoven-produced “Not Playin” and the single’s coinciding visual. “‘Not Playin’ is one of my favorite tracks that Q and I had recorded, because it has that real authentic trap bounce. I decided to work with Q when I first saw one of his videos,” Zay explains. “I knew then he was a star, so I sent Q’s manager some beats and when he sent the songs back, it was a confirmation to me that he was definitely a superstar.”
